Hello,

while having used Captivate for a while now, I feel I am still a novice, and there are some advanced functions that I still have not mastered – and that is my current situation, so please excuse the lack of correct terminology as I try to explain my problem.

A contractor has built our module for us, and provided the file so I can edit and keep it current, but with this particular slide, there is a menu with buttons to reveal new information on the slide – but I cannot reveal them in the cptx version so I can edit the content.

Is someone able to advise me what I need to do?  I have attached the slide to assist.Where are the layers

In your project, please look for SmartShape “SmartShape_667”. This SmartShape has multiple states. Please go to “State View” for this object and you will find your content for editing. Hope it helps.
